About The Position

Join our team to architect and develop cutting-edge hardware/software co-design solutions for ASIC/FPGA-based acceleration across a wide range of applications—such as networking, storage, automotive, aerospace, and emerging AI/ML workloads. You will design high-performance hardware acceleration engines and embedded software that orchestrates them, enabling next-generation compute platforms. You are passionate about modern processor architecture, digital design, and system-level validation. You thrive in collaborative environments, communicate effectively across global teams, and bring strong analytical and problem-solving skills. You are eager to learn and tackle complex technical challenges.

Requirements

  • Bachelors or Masters degree in computer engineering/Electrical Engineering

Nice To Haves

  • Hands-on experience with ASIC/FPGAs
  • RTL Expertise: Expert in SystemVerilog/Verilog, synchronous design, and timing closure for high-speed logic
  • Protocols: Knowledge of PCIe, AXI, DDR, and Ethernet. Familiarity with CXL or UAL is highly desirable
  • Verification: Familiarity with UVM-based verification frameworks and emulation platforms (Palladium, Protium, Zebu)
  • Validation: Experience in hardware debugging
  • Tools: Proficiency in Python, Tcl, Makefiles, and Shell scripting for automation

Responsibilities

  • Participate in technical role in all phases of the product development cycle from new product exploration, architecture through implementation, prototyping, validation, productization and support including but not limited to architecture, design, and documentation for Ips
  • Collaborate with architects, hardware engineers, and firmware engineers to understand the new features to be developed
  • RTL Development: Design, verify, and validate high-performance logic using System Verilog/Verilog. You will focus on the data and control path, implementing deigns for PCIe (Gen 6/7), CXL, UAL, Ethernet, and DDR5/6.
  • System Level Integration: Utilize the standard ASIC flows , AMD (Xilinx) Vivado ecosystems to integrate custom IP with other subsystems
  • Pre-Si Verification: Perform pre-silicon verification and emulation to ensure functional correctness and performance
  • Post-Si Validation: Lead the "Bring-up" process in the lab. Perform post-silicon validation, debugging complex interactions between the embedded software and hardware fabric
